HC Deb 05 August 1947 vol 441 c1386

Ordered: That the Select Committee on Estimates have power to appoint a Sub-Committee to visit Germany and to hold sittings for the purpose of hearing evidence from British officials and from representatives of British interests on matters arising out of the Estimate for the Foreign Office (German Section), and the Navy, Army and Air Estimates, so far as they relate to the cost of maintaining British forces in Germany; and that it be an instruction to any Sub-Committee so appointed that they inquire specially into the arrangements for British participation in the economic organisation and administration in Gerfnany.—[Mr. Kirby.]
